Unveiling the Meaning and Origin
The name "Chony" doesn’t have a widely documented meaning in traditional baby name references. Unlike names with clear etymologies, "Chony" remains somewhat of an enigma, which I find quite enchanting. It’s primarily used in Spanish-speaking cultures and is often considered a diminutive or affectionate form of other names. This practice of creating affectionate nicknames is very common in Hispanic cultures, where names are lovingly adapted to express closeness and endearment.
The Art of Nicknaming: Affection in a Name
In many Spanish families, names evolve into nicknames that carry deep emotional significance. "Chony" is one such nickname. It’s often used as a stand-alone name now but started as a tender form of longer names. Some affectionate nicknames related to "Chony" include Chonita, Chonchi, Choni, and Chonny, among others. These variations highlight the playfulness and creativity within the culture’s naming traditions.
